網(wǎng)頁動態(tài)效果是現(xiàn)代網(wǎng)頁設(shè)計(jì)中不可或缺的一部分,它能夠吸引用戶的注意力,提高網(wǎng)站的交互性和用戶體驗(yàn),在CSS中,我們可以使用多種方法來實(shí)現(xiàn)網(wǎng)頁動態(tài)效果,以下是一些常見的方法:
1、使用CSS動畫:CSS動畫是CSS3中引入的功能,它允許您創(chuàng)建持續(xù)時間、延遲時間和循環(huán)次數(shù)等屬性的動畫效果,通過定義關(guān)鍵幀(keyframes),您可以輕松地創(chuàng)建復(fù)雜的動畫效果。
2、使用CSS過渡:CSS過渡是一種簡單而強(qiáng)大的技術(shù),它允許您在兩個狀態(tài)之間添加平滑的過渡效果,您可以使用過渡效果來更改元素的透明度、顏色或大小等屬性。
3、使用JavaScript和CSS:雖然CSS本身可以實(shí)現(xiàn)一些動態(tài)效果,但結(jié)合JavaScript可以創(chuàng)建更加復(fù)雜和交互性強(qiáng)的效果,您可以使用JavaScript來檢測用戶的操作(如點(diǎn)擊或滾動),并根據(jù)這些操作來更新CSS樣式或觸發(fā)動畫效果。
在實(shí)現(xiàn)網(wǎng)頁動態(tài)效果時,您還需要注意一些性能和可訪問性問題,確保您的動畫效果不會過于復(fù)雜或消耗過多的系統(tǒng)資源,同時確保您的網(wǎng)站在各種設(shè)備和瀏覽器上都能夠正常顯示和工作。
CSS是一種強(qiáng)大的工具,可以用于創(chuàng)建各種網(wǎng)頁動態(tài)效果,通過不斷學(xué)習(xí)和實(shí)踐,您可以掌握更多的CSS技巧和方法,為您的網(wǎng)頁設(shè)計(jì)增添更多的樂趣和創(chuàng)意。